What's The Definition Of Stupe?
stupe in American English 1
a soft cloth dipped in hot water, wrung dry, often medicated, and applied to the body as a compress noun: two or more layers of flannel or other cloth soaked in hot water and applied to the skin as a counterirritant stupe in American English 2 noun: a stupid person stupe in British English 1 noun: a hot damp cloth, usually sprinkled with an irritant, applied to the body to relieve pain by counterirritation stupe in British English 2 noun: a stupid person; clot |
